Air Reformer for Fisheries

Maintain the freshness of live fish and improve transportation efficiency.

In live fish transportation within the fishing industry, it is important to maintain the freshness of the fish and reduce mortality rates during transport. Oxygen deficiency and deterioration of water quality can increase stress in fish, potentially leading to quality degradation and death. An air reformer (AR) contributes to maintaining the vitality of live fish and improving the survival rate of fish during transport by increasing the dissolved oxygen levels in the water and improving water quality. 【Usage Scenarios】 Live fish transport vehicles Live fish transport vessels 【Effects of Implementation】 Preservation of fish freshness Reduction of mortality rates during transport Suppression of water quality deterioration

Applications/Examples of results

Fish farming Marine fish farming Freshwater fish farming Ornamental fish farming Supports the healthy growth of fish through improvements in water quality. Shrimp farming Black tiger shrimp Vannamei shrimp, etc. Prevents oxygen depletion after feeding, leading to an expected increase in survival rates. Live fish tanks and aquaculture facilities Live fish tanks Aquaculture market tanks Aquariums Supports stabilization of water quality and reduction of fish stress. Examples of water environment improvement achievements Increase in dissolved oxygen levels In conditions where dissolved oxygen levels hardly change with normal aeration, it has been reported that aeration using AR increased dissolved oxygen levels by about 53 times. Reduction in mortality rates of farmed fish Oxygen depletion, which is likely to occur during feed digestion, has been improved, confirming a decrease in mortality rates of farmed fish and shrimp. Water quality improvement Promotion of decomposition of leftover feed and waste Reduction of BOD and COD Improvement of water self-purification ability Reduction of unpleasant odors Stabilization of the water environment is expected to improve aquaculture conditions.
